Setting Your Investment Goals
Before investing, it’s essential to define your financial goals. Are you saving for retirement, a home, or your child’s education? Knowing your goals can help you determine how much money you can invest and the kind of risk you are willing to take. To achieve your objectives, create a budget that allocates funds for investing while also ensuring you can cover your everyday expenses.
Choosing the Right Investment Account
Once you have your goals set, it’s time to choose the right investment account. There are various types of accounts available, such as individual brokerage accounts and retirement accounts like IRAs and 401(k)s. Each account type offers different tax advantages and investment options, so be sure to research which one best aligns with your long-term financial strategy.
